"In a hole in the ground there lived a hobbit" - the opening line of J.R.R. Tolkien's The Hobbit is among the most famous first lines in literature, and introduces readers to the most homely fantasy creatures ever invented: the Hobbits. Hobbits are a race of half-sized people, very similar to humans except for their hairy feet.

The Hobbit, or There and Back Again, better known as The Hobbit, is a children's fantasy novel by J.R.R. Tolkien. It was published on 21 September 1937 to wide critical acclaim. The book remains popular and is recognized as a classic in children's literature.
